Replace DateTime with proper functions (#32402)
Follow #32383 This PR cleans up the "Deadline" usages in templates, make them call `ParseLegacy` first to get a `Time` struct then display by `DateUtils`. Now it should be pretty clear how "deadline string" works, it makes it possible to do further refactoring and correcting.
